The challenge of public-private partnerships : learning from international experience/ edited by Graeme Hodge and Carsten Greve

Subject(s): Summary: Following a short account of the sometimes uncomfortable history of public-private joint ventures the book presents examples of present day approaches - some successful some less so - to PPP around the world. Discusses the range of concepts covered by PPP and the kinds of service and infrastructure projects handled under PPP arrangements. Concludes by assessing the present state of PPP undertakings noting among other things the long term commitments often involved.
